CLASS net/minecraft/class_8673 net/minecraft/client/network/ClientCommonNetworkHandler FIELD field_45588 client Lnet/minecraft/class_310; FIELD field_45589 connection Lnet/minecraft/class_2535; FIELD field_45590 serverInfo Lnet/minecraft/class_642; FIELD field_45591 brand Ljava/lang/String; FIELD field_45592 worldSession Lnet/minecraft/class_7975; FIELD field_45593 postDisconnectScreen Lnet/minecraft/class_437; FIELD field_45594 LOST_CONNECTION_TEXT Lnet/minecraft/class_2561; FIELD field_45595 queuedPackets Ljava/util/List; FIELD field_45944 LOGGER Lorg/slf4j/Logger; FIELD field_48399 serverCookies Ljava/util/Map; FIELD field_51516 transferring Z METHOD (Lnet/minecraft/class_310;Lnet/minecraft/class_2535;Lnet/minecraft/class_8675;)V ARG 1 client ARG 2 connection ARG 3 connectionState METHOD method_11152 onCustomPayload (Lnet/minecraft/class_8710;)V ARG 1 payload METHOD method_52773 getParsedResourcePackUrl (Ljava/lang/String;)Ljava/net/URL; ARG 0 url METHOD method_52778 getPrompt (Lnet/minecraft/class_2561;Lnet/minecraft/class_2561;)Lnet/minecraft/class_2561; ARG 0 requirementPrompt ARG 1 customPrompt METHOD method_52779 send (Lnet/minecraft/class_2596;Ljava/util/function/BooleanSupplier;Ljava/time/Duration;)V ARG 1 packet ARG 2 sendCondition ARG 3 expiry METHOD method_52786 createDisconnectedScreen (Lnet/minecraft/class_2561;)Lnet/minecraft/class_437; ARG 1 reason METHOD method_52787 sendPacket (Lnet/minecraft/class_2596;)V ARG 1 packet METHOD method_52789 sendQueuedPackets ()V METHOD method_52790 getBrand ()Ljava/lang/String; METHOD method_55511 (Ljava/util/UUID;)V ARG 1 id METHOD method_55609 createConfirmServerResourcePackScreen (Ljava/util/UUID;Ljava/net/URL;Ljava/lang/String;ZLnet/minecraft/class_2561;)Lnet/minecraft/class_437; ARG 1 id ARG 2 url ARG 3 hash ARG 4 required ARG 5 prompt CLASS class_8137 QueuedPacket CLASS class_9058 ConfirmServerResourcePackScreen FIELD field_47682 packs Ljava/util/List; FIELD field_47683 parent Lnet/minecraft/class_437; METHOD (Lnet/minecraft/class_8673;Lnet/minecraft/class_310;Lnet/minecraft/class_437;Ljava/util/List;ZLnet/minecraft/class_2561;)V ARG 2 client ARG 3 parent ARG 4 pack ARG 5 required ARG 6 prompt METHOD method_55612 (Lnet/minecraft/class_310;Lnet/minecraft/class_437;ZLjava/util/List;Lnet/minecraft/class_8673;Z)V ARG 5 confirmed METHOD method_55613 add (Lnet/minecraft/class_310;Ljava/util/UUID;Ljava/net/URL;Ljava/lang/String;ZLnet/minecraft/class_2561;)Lnet/minecraft/class_8673$class_9058; ARG 1 client ARG 2 id ARG 3 url ARG 4 hash ARG 5 required ARG 6 prompt CLASS class_9059 Pack